Week 6 Trial - Completed the challenge

The deed is done. It feels sort of anti-climatic but I did it. It probably just needs a few minutes to sync in. I've been able to complete 100 consecutive push up.

Daily Total: 100
Overall Total: 7271

To prep for this, I gave myself an extra day of rest, and drank a big glass of water one hour before the attempt. I also got myself psyched up and stretched a bit just before the attempt.

As I knocked out the first 30 pushups it felt harder than expected. That was a bit discouraging, but I reminded myself that the first 50 were "just a warm up".

Approaching 70 they got alot tougher and I paused at 80. Taking a second I shook out each arm. That's something I never do, but it seemed needed.

I managed the next 10 and then started pushing them one at a time. It was sooo hard and very painfull.

But I did it! :-)
It feels great that I've completed the hundred.

Wednesday, October 29, 2008

Week 6 Day 2 - Repeat 2

OMG. Ouch. That workout hurt.

Program: 30,30,25,25,25,25,22,22, max (at least 56)
Actual: 30,30,25,25,25,25,22,22,60
Daily Total: 264
Overall Total: 6424

I've really tried to maximize this week's workouts to get a final boost before shooting for the hundred this weekend.

So I made sure that every pushup was really good form, and I've really been trying to max out that last set.

The first two sets of thirty were no problem.
The next couple of sets hurt a bit, but I told myself "no problem" with those too.
The 3rd set of 25 was a little tougher, and I had to pause at number 20 on the fourth set of 25.
I managed the next couple sets (of 22) but paused around 17 or 18.

For the final set I let myself rest a full minute. That last set is a lot of pushups you know.

I got to 20 and paused, and thought let's do them in sets of 20 then. Pushed out another 20 and started on a final set of 20. Only made it to 10 before pausing again. Ok sets of 10 then... paused again 5 later, and then finished the final 5.

So, gasping for air with my head throbbing but I completed the final 60.

My heart's still thumping.
